You might love it, you might hate it. In the end, no matter how you feel about it - sight reading forms part of any instrument you want to learn or play. What Is Sight Reading? According to the Oxford dictionary, it is the ability to read and perform music from sheet music, without preparation. Sight reading is often seen as a sore thumb in many pianists’ lives since they struggle with it. Keys Full Of Passion: The Piano’s Role In The Romantic Period

2024-10-03T10:55:22+01:00

The Romantic Period was the start of dramatic music full of passion and life, with the piano playing a significant role during the era! After the French Revolution, artists used the atmosphere it created as inspiration for their works. People became more open and public about their objections, which radiated through musician’s compositions. Romanticism was mainly a reaction against political and social injustice. It was also a way of rebelling against the industrial revolution that replaced people’s jobs with machines. That probably explains why romantic music is so expressive and dramatic.
